Abstract

The invention provides an embedded fabric and a weaving process thereof. The embedded fabric comprises a 3/1 surface fabric, a 2/2 medium fabric and a 1/3 inner fabric. The process comprises the steps of spooling; beaming; slashing; denting; weaving; finishing. According to the embedded fabric and the weaving process, the inner fabric is woven according to the process requirement; twill strips are formed on the fabric surface and are connected to form the embedded fabric; the types of embedded yarns can be adjusted; low-elastic yarns can be embedded to improve the comfort, conductive yarns can be embedded to prevent static, and breathable fiber yarns can be embedded to improve the capacity of moisture absorption and sweat releasing; therefore, the corresponding functions can be achieved, and the problem that the embedded weaving cannot be performed in the traditional weaving process can be solved; embedded fabric has the characteristics of being simple in process, small in difficult at weaving and little in consumption of special weaving devices; an embedded fabric type textile product is added for the textile field.

Description

Embedded fabric and weaving process thereof
Technical field
The present invention relates to textile technology field, is a kind of embedded fabric and weaving process thereof specifically.
Background technology
At present in existing weaving technology, traditional fabric knitting technique can only loom for weaving double-layered jacquard fabric, and along with the raising of people's living standard, require also more and more higher to the class of fabric, some comfortablenesses, functional cloth are favored by people gradually, and the material embedding actual needs between in fabric table is more and more important and urgent.But, can be irregular and be difficult to weave due to warp-wise tension force if embed special yarn along warp-wise, because yarn is different, its tension force difference, two kinds of different tension force make gate assignment problem cause and cannot drive, also will increase heald frame number of pages simultaneously and make to weave more difficult to cause same beam of a loom to occur.
Summary of the invention
For overcoming the deficiencies in the prior art, goal of the invention of the present invention is to provide a kind of embedded fabric and weaving process thereof, by embedding the mode of special yarn along broadwise, solve the problem that conventional woven technique cannot produce embedded fabric, realize existing ordinary loom and weave embedded fabric.
For achieving the above object, embedded fabric of the present invention is made up of top layer fabric, intermediate fabric and nexine fabric.
Described top layer fabric is 3/1 twill-weave fabric.
Described intermediate fabric is 2/2 twill-weave fabric.
Described bottom fabric layer is 1/3 twill-weave fabric.
The warp thread direction top layer fabric of described embedded fabric, intermediate fabric and bottom fabric layer are arranged as 1 table: in 1: 1 li.
The embedding yarn of described embedded fabric is low-stretch yarn, conductive filament, air-conditioning fiber yarn.
The weaving process of the embedded fabric of the present invention, comprises the following steps:
(1) winding procedure: adopt field, village fully-automatic spooling machine, becomes the bobbin that capacity is large, forming has certain density by incidental looping, and removal of impurities, remove fault and impurity on yarn;
(2) warping process: draw on doff bobbin with Benniger warping machines, forms a width yarn sheet, the speed of a motor vehicle 500 ms/min;
(3) sizing operation: adopt field, Tianjin coltfoal Sizing machines, single leaching is two presses slurry; Sizing squeezing pressure: 1.4 ~ 1.6 × 10KN, steam pressure: 0.42 ~ 0.67MPa, slurry groove temperature: 80 DEG C ~ 85 DEG C, main cylinder temperature: 60 DEG C ~ 95 DEG C, slurry viscosity: 15 seconds, max. speed: 45 ms/min;
(4) denting operation: by warp thread by the method for following textile processes requirement defined successively through menopause tablet, heald and reed, all adopting along wearing method, adopting 4 to enter/detain the method for wearing;
The method of wearing is: 1,2,3,4, and which page heald frame digitized representation warp thread is through on;
(5) weaving process: adopt multi-arm air-jet loom, opening time 290 degree, back beam height 50mm, the warp let-off time 310 degree, warp let-off tension force 3000 Ns, the speed of a motor vehicle 440 revs/min, adopts the production technology of " hightension, little opening "; The back rest is 80mm × 1, warp stop frame high scale line is No2.1-2-6, and the back rest is pushed ahead; By opening, wefting insertion, beat up, batch the cooperation with warp let-off five big systems, use the yarn of designing requirement and fabric table, bottom crossing, use the embedding yarn needed with weft accumulator two with weft accumulator one, making to interweave according to the requirement of design through weft yarn forms fabric;
(6) arranging process: grey cloth is tested, measure and repairs.
The present invention compared with prior art, utilizes existing loom to produce embedded fabric, solves conventional woven technique and cannot produce an Embedded difficult problem.The present invention is equivalent to three layers of cloth, embedded in the special yarn of one deck between textile surface and bottom.Embed low-stretch yarn and can increase comfortableness, embedding conductive filament can antistatic, embeds air-conditioning fiber yarn and can strengthen moisture absorbing and sweat releasing ability etc.Have technique simple, difficulty of weaving is little, the feature that the consumption of weaving equipment special is few, and can be field of textiles increases a kind of Embedded textile product.
